如何在php风暴的Mongo Explorer插件中通过id搜索文档

abb*_*ood 7 php mongodb phpstorm robo3t

我使用robomongorockmongo作为mongo dbs的客户端..假设我有一个名为Drivers的集合,那么通过id搜索很容易:

db.Driver.find({_id:ObjectId('51118447b38639a960000002')})
Run Code Online (Sandbox Code Playgroud)

我最近为Php Storm安装了一个mongo插件,但我无法弄清楚如何通过id搜索文档..以上查询失败:

在此输入图像描述

想法?

Bat*_*eam 15

根据支持论坛,您应该查询为:

{_id: {$oid: '51118447b38639a960000002'}}
Run Code Online (Sandbox Code Playgroud)

  • 惊呆了,这不在指南中.为什么不支持_id:ObjectId('....') (3认同)